## Service account: Tallygrid barcode scanner integration

Plugins that push scan events into Tallygrid must use a dedicated service account rather than a personal login. This account is scoped to the scan-ingest endpoint only; it cannot read inventory records or modify device registrations. Rotate its credentials whenever your plugin ships a major version, and never embed them in client-side bundles. For local development against the Tallygrid sandbox, configure your client with the service account's API key shown below.

API key for tagug-tajef: vxb4-R1fo

Capacity note: the AgriLink telemetry gateway ingests burst traffic when Harrowfield tractors reconnect after field dead zones. Plan for reconnect storms, not steady-state averages. Buffer sizing and shard counts were set after last harvest season's incident; don't change them without a soak test. Current tuning constants for the ingest tier are as follows.

tuning constants:
QUOTAS = {
    "druwyn": 5,
    "holix": 5,
    "zorath": 5,
    "holwyn": 10,
}

# Greatleaf Receipt Mailer — Environments

The Greatleaf donation-receipt mailer runs in three environments: dev, staging, and production. Dev uses a mail-capture sink; staging sends only to an internal allowlist; production sends to real donors. Queue depth and template versions are pinned per environment, and secrets are injected at deploy time. The production environment currently runs with the following configuration values.

deployment values, yafop-tahof:
HOLIX_HOST=holix.zemvarsys.internal
HOLIX_PORT=3306

**Ticket: Cursor pagination skips records under concurrent writes**

The public listing endpoint in the Fernwick API uses offset-based pagination, so rows inserted mid-scan shift the window and clients silently miss records. Observed by the Drosselbank integration team during a bulk export. Proposed fix: switch to keyset cursors on the created-at column plus a tiebreaker. Workaround for now: sort descending and retry gaps. For reproduction, use the staging build identified by the token below.

build token for fahap-yagag: htk3_d09